SJU Smart Motorway Team Clerk & SJU Safety Camera & Ticket Enforcement Team Clerk

  • Company:Hampshire & Isle of Wight Constabulary
  • Reference:HC621860
  • Remuneration:£27,204 - £29,859 per annum
  • Role/type:Permanent
  • Location:Whiteley, Parkway, Nearby parking and excellent links to motorway. Located near shops, cafes and local walks.
Apply now

Are you looking for a role that has a positive impact on road safety? We are looking for individuals to join our SJU Smart Motorway Team  & SJU Safety Camera & Ticket Enforcement Team, who are committed to improving road safety. You will need a good understanding of IT systems and have a positive mindset to learning.   The role involves improving Road Safety through education and enforcement. You will need good communication skills with an ability to work accurately while performing a variety of clerical tasks.

What are the roles:

SJU Smart Motorway Team Clerk- HC621860

SJU Safety Camera & Ticket Enforcement Team Clerk

 

Location: Whiteley, Parkway, Nearby parking and excellent links to motorway. Located near shops, cafes and local walks.

 

Salary: Scale 4, £27,204 – £29,859 per annum

 

Hours: 37 hours per week  – (Flexi Monday – Friday between  08.00 – 17.00)

Contract: Permanent

 

Closing Date:  Tuesday 12th May 2026  at 23:59 hours

About The Role

We are looking for team members who are accurate and have good attention to detail in their work, share good interpersonal skills and maintain a high level of professionalism. You will build and use investigative skills, as part of a team. Your duties will include:

Providing administrative support to the team

  • Creating, updating and maintaining records
  • Interrogating a variety of secure databases as necessary
  • Liaising with an array of various agencies, companies and individuals both internal and external
  • Dealing with correspondence via email, letter and telephone
  • Using a range of specialised equipment to quality assure supporting evidence to a level required by Court.

Full bespoke training package provided during the first 12 weeks of appointment.

What We Need From You

 

You should be educated to QCF Level 2 (3-5 passes) OR have proven significant work experience deemed to have brought the post holder to a comparable level.

Experience of working in a busy administrative environment and undertaking complex administrative tasks to a high standard.

Experience of dealing with the public would be desirable

What We Offer

 

As an employer, Hampshire and Isle of Wight Constabulary also offers many other benefits which include:

An attractive contributory pension scheme.
Childcare Voucher and Cycle to Work schemes.
Access to Hampshire Police Leisure and Sport (providing a range of family and sporting activities).
Gym facilities at a number of our buildings.
Access to retail and hospitality benefits via the Blue Light Card (Welcome to Blue Light Card).
Progression throughout Hampshire Constabulary.
